DraftKings, FanDuel Pitchers - MLB DFS Lineup Picks

Corbin Burnes -P, MIL vs. CHC ($10,500 DK, $11,200 FD)

Burnes has pitched to a 4-1 mark, 2.03 ERA, 0.90 WHIP, and 11.6 K/9 across his last five starts, and he's holding both handednesses of hitters to well under a .200 average. The dominant right-hander also stymied the Cubs over seven innings in his last meeting with them on May 1st, recording 10 strikeouts. Chicago has been productive over the last month against right-handers on the road with a .760 OPS and .333 wOBA, but Burnes owns a .190 average and .273 wOBA across 49.1 home frames, and he already has six starts with double-digit strikeouts, five of them having come at American Family Field.

Shane Bieber - P, CLE at DET ($9,100 DK, $10,100 FD)

Bieber comes into Wednesday's turn with four straight quality starts, and he's pitched to a 2.62 ERA, 1.15 WHIP, 9.9 K/9, and 0.6 HR/9 across the 58.1 innings covering his last nine starts. Within that sample are back-to-back starts against this same Tigers team where he generated a 1-1 record, 1.80 ERA, 1.07 WHIP, and 15:2 K:BB. The right-hander has also been at his best on the road, where he's posted a 2.51 ERA, 1.13 WHIP, 0.9 HR/9, and .294 wOBA. Meanwhile, Detroit has just a .279 wOBA and -10.2 wRAA at home against right-handed pitching over the last month, and current Tigers bats own a paltry .152/.205/.229 collective slash line against him in 162 career plate appearances.

DraftKings, FanDuel Infielders - MLB DFS Lineup Picks

Freddie Freeman - 1B, LAD vs. Jose Urena ($5,000 DK, $4,200 FD)

Freeman went into Tuesday night's action with a .302/.384/.492 slash line, figures that he's arrived at thanks to a torrid 16-game stretch where he's posted a 1.108 OPS, 10 XBH, and 16 RBI. The left-handed slugger has been lethal against right-handed pitching at home as well, furnishing a .337 average, .414 wOBA, and 170 wRC+, plus a 25.3 percent line-drive rate, in that split. Meanwhile, Urena is allowing a career-high 10.7 percent barrel rate, and his .270 xBA, .576 xSLG, .399 xwOBA, and 6.31 xERA all betray his much more respectable surface numbers. Finally, consider Urena is already allowing a .308 average and .413 wOBA to lefty bats, and he's given up .325 and .399 figures in those respective categories to left-handed hitters over the course of his career.

Jose Altuve - 2B, HOU vs. Brad Keller ($5,600 DK, $4,300 FD)

Altuve heads into Wednesday's contest with a stellar .892 OPS, and he's tormented right-handed pitching at home for a .310 average, .386 wOBA, and 159 wRC+. Keller has a .278 xBA and .337 xwOBA overall, and his atrocious 3.4 K/9 against righty bats on the road is just asking for trouble. Keller is already giving up a .264 batting average to right-handed hitters when traveling, and he happens to draw a very bad matchup in Altuve when it comes to two of his three top pitches, the four-seam fastball and sinker. Altuve boasts .518 and .404 wOBAs against those pitches, strengthening his already strong case after he put together a .325 average and 1.099 OPS over the 11 games heading into Tuesday night's action.

Andres Gimenez - SS, CLE at Michael Pineda ($4,000 DK, $2,700 FD)

Gimenez makes for an excellent left-handed foil for Pineda, who's allowed a .296 average, .374 wOBA, 2.7 HR/9, 6.64 FIP, and 40.4 percent hard-contact rate to lefty bats. Gimenez went into Tuesday night's action with a .300 average and .839 OPS, and he's pounded right-handed pitching for a .319 average, .933 OPS, .396 wOBA, and 163 wRC+ on the road. The hot-hitting infielder has a massive 29.2 percent line-drive rate versus righties on the road as well, while Pineda's .319 xBA, .608 xSLG, .398 xwOBA, and 6.27 xERA all underscore how ripe his 3.62 ERA and 1.13 WHIP are for some serious regression.

Yandy Diaz- 3B, TB at Brayan Bello ($4,000 DK, $3,000 FD)

Diaz is a solid right-handed bat to deploy against Bello in his first MLB start. The rookie has been very impressive at both the Double-A and Triple-A levels already this season, but Diaz checks in with an excellent .290 average and .405 OBP following a 3-for-4 night Tuesday. The burly infielder went into Tuesday's action already sporting a .292 average, .742 OPS, and .338 wOBA against right-handed pitching on the road, as well as a .421 average and .433 wOBA over 22 July plate appearances before his aforementioned success Tuesday.

DraftKings, FanDuel Outfielders - MLB DFS Lineup Picks

Adolis Garcia - OF, TEX at Spenser Watkins ($4,900 DK, $3,900 FD)

Garcia had a rough 0-for-5, three-strikeout night Tuesday, but he's impressively laced 34 of his 75 hits for extra bases and had a .274 average, .348 wOBA, .237 ISO, 26.8 percent line-drive rate, and 39.0 percent hard-contact rate versus right-handed pitching. Watkins has been particularly taken to task by right-handed bats at home as well, yielding a .333 average, .445 wOBA, 1.7 HR/9, and 6.80 xFIP in that split. The right-hander is sporting a .296 xBA, .390 xwOBA, and 5.97 xERA as well, and his abysmal 12.6 percent strikeout rate could certainly spell trouble against a hitter the caliber of Garcia.

Trey Mancini - OF, BAL vs. Glenn Otto ($4,000 DK, $3,000 FD)

Mancini posted a 2-for-4 night Tuesday that pushed his season slash line to an impressive .281/.357/.428. The veteran could be in for another productive night against Otto, who's allowed a .298 average, .387 wOBA, 1.68 WHIP, and 5.40 xFIP to right-handed hitters. Mancini boasts a .294/.365/.482 slash line and .365 wOBA versus righties at home as well, and he's also been a very effective hitter against Otto's top two pitches, the sinker (.312 average, .360 wOBA) and the four-seam fastball (.313 average .426 wOBA).

Taylor Ward - OF, LAA at Trevor Rogers ($4,300 DK, $3,500 FD)

Rogers has experienced some significant regression this season, carrying a .276 xBA and .357 xwOBA into Wednesday's start. What's more, Rogers has seen a major drop in strikeout rate from last season's 28.5 percent to a 20.1 percent figure thus far this season, and his walk rate is also sitting at a career-high 11.0 percent. The southpaw's vulnerabilities dovetail perfectly for fantasy purposes with Ward's offensive profile, as the stellar outfielder entered Tuesday night's action with a .409 wOBA and 13.3 percent walk rate overall, and a .433 wOBA, .259 ISO, and 189 wRC+ versus left-handed pitching. Additionally, Rogers has been decimated by righty bats at home, giving up a .337 average, .434 wOBA, and 2.9 HR/9 in that split.
